Cobblestone Installation in Denver County, CO
Cobblestone installation services involve laying durable, aesthetically appealing stone pavers to enhance outdoor spaces such as driveways, walkways, patios, and garden paths. This process typically includes preparing the ground, selecting the appropriate type of cobblestones, and carefully installing them to ensure a stable, long-lasting surface. Homeowners often request this service to improve curb appeal, create functional outdoor areas, or restore existing stone features with a classic, timeless look.
Before requesting cobblestone installation, property owners usually want to understand the scope of the project, including the types of stones available, design options, and the level of maintenance involved. It is also helpful to consider the current condition of the site, such as grading and drainage needs, to ensure proper installation. Clarifying these details can support a smoother process and help align expectations for the finished outdoor space.

Cobblestone Installation Questions
What types of surfaces are suitable for cobblestone installation? Cobblestones are ideal for driveways, walkways, patios, and garden paths, providing a durable and classic appearance.
How long does a cobblestone installation typically take? The duration depends on the project size and complexity, but installation generally involves preparation, laying, and finishing steps.
Are cobblestones suitable for high-traffic areas? Yes, cobblestones are highly durable and can withstand frequent foot or vehicle traffic with proper installation.
What maintenance is required for cobblestone surfaces? Regular cleaning and occasional re-sanding help maintain the appearance and stability of cobblestone surfaces over time.
